What are the two main components of the data model? - ANSWER - Entities & Type lists
What is the purpose of the data dictionary? - ANSWER - - It shows the data elements that belong to entities and type lists
- How existing and custom fields can be configured
What are some of the relationships between entities - ANSWER - 1.Fields - atomic data stored about the entity (non-restricted values
- Type keys - a single reference to a value in a type list 3 / 4
pg. 4
- Array keys - a set of references to another entity
- Foreign keys - a single reference to the id of another entity
